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• Electrical:

    Inspect electrical equipment such as wiring, conduit, panels, switch gear, gauges, transducers, solenoids, gas dryers, actuators, motors, meters and controls for safe and proper operating condition.

    Report issues to the Maintenance Planner or designated Technician or Supervisor to schedule repair, replacement, and adjustment of malfunctioning equipment to restore proper operating condition as specified in regulations and repair manuals.

  • Mechanical:

    Inspect mechanical equipment such as compressors, pumps, engines, intercoolers, after coolers, heat exchangers, piping, tubing, fittings, filters, traps, gas dryers, fasteners, valves and actuators for safe and proper operating condition.

    Report issues to the Maintenance Planner or designated Technician or Supervisor to schedule repair, replacement, and adjustment of malfunctioning equipment to restore proper operating condition as specified in regulations and repair manuals.

  • General:

    Make scheduled inspections of CNG, LNG and/or LCNG fueling locations and equipment to determine proper and normal operating conditions in accordance with Clean Energy standard operating procedures.

    Diagnose and correct faulty and malfunctioning mechanical and/or electrical components related to CNG, LNG and/or LCNG.

    Clean and maintain fueling locations.

    Drive to or between company sites to perform job responsibilities.

    Update and document all activity, service orders, work performed and recommendation in our D365 Clean Energy Field Service Automation (FSA) software. Must be proficient on a personal computer, laptop, and mobile devices.

    Maintain all fueling related equipment and structures in accordance with manufacturer requirements and Clean Energy standard operating procedures.

    Coverage at other stations in neighboring states may be required due to business needs and advancement criteria.

    Availability to be on‑call 24/7 outside of normal business hours may be required.

    Availability during off‑duty hours as required including potential overtime hours.

    Other duties as assigned.
